REMOVINGINSTALLING Remove/install     
1 Switch off ignition and store transmitter key outside of transmission range (min. 2 m). NOTES
All electrical consumers must be switched off. Danger of damage to consumers when disconnecting/connecting ground line (2).
 
2 Release cover (1) in direction of arrow and remove. Model 118, 177, 247  
3 Unfasten nut (3) and remove ground line (2) from negative pole of on-board electrical system battery (G1).

4 Install in the reverse order.    
BATTERY

Number Designation Model 243
BA54.10-P-1003-01M Nut, electrical line to negative terminal/positive terminal of on-board electrical system battery Nm 6
BATTERY

Number Designation Model 118 Model 177
BA54.10-P-1005-01D Nut, ground line (battery sensor) to battery terminal Nm 6 6
BATTERY

Number Designation Model 247
BA54.10-P-1005-01D Nut, ground line (battery sensor) to battery terminal Nm 6
